**The Opportunity**

A rare and fantastic opportunity as an Executive Assistant to our new CEO will see you play a crucial role in supporting our CEO achieve sustainable success for the City of Stirling.

The Executive Assistant to the new CEO is a key position within the City of Stirling, providing high-level proactive support to the CEO, ensuring the efficient and effective operation of the Office of the CEO in alignment with the City’s values.

The Executive Assistant provides seamless support and collaborates across all levels of the organisation and provides a key liaison role between the CEO, Mayor, Elected Members, employees and external stakeholders. As the primary point of contact on all matters pertaining to the CEO, this dynamic and fast paced position demonstrates exceptional communication skills, initiative, adaptability and discretion whilst being committed to always maintaining confidentiality.

With a customer-centric approach, the Executive Assistant to the CEO ensures excellence in service delivery both internally and externally. This is an opportunity to support new ideas, new solutions and to make a difference in the City’s future.

**This permanent full-time position (5 days per week)** is a Level 7 Inside Workforce Agreement position which attract a salary from $93,235.12 - $98,143.25 gross pro rata per annum plus superannuation.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Deliver strategic, efficient and proactive administrative support to the CEO, handling confidential and sensitive matters with tact and discretion.
- Proactively manage the CEO’s dynamic schedule including diary management, meetings, travel arrangements and document management to ensure the day-to-day operations of the CEO are effectively coordinated.
- Act as the CEO’s principal contact point and a key liaison with the Mayor, Elected Members and stakeholders, collaborating closely with the Executive Team and senior officers to ensure timely communication with the CEO regarding critical matters.
- Coordinating meetings for the Executive Team, including preparation and distribution of papers, following up on actions and minuting meeting as required.
- Coordination and management of employee events, such as employee briefings, functions and meetings (internal and external) volunteering and charity activities.
- Contribute to transparent and ethical governance that is responsible, clear and in line with legislative requirements and standards to ensure the CEO meets all legislative obligations relating to declarations for Council meetings, gift disclosures, travel and annual returns.
- Take a proactive role in sharing continuous improvement, enhanced technologies, identifying corporate issues and offering potential solutions.
